Selecting a compound bow that fits you properly is an essential first step to becoming proficient with this type of bow and arrow. A properly fitted bow will enable you to shoot more accurately, effectively, and with increased strength and endurance.
Bow Weight: When choosing a bow weight for yourself, aim for one that feels comfortable to hold and control. Aim for an ideal balance between light and heavy so that you can easily control your bow without feeling overly fatigued after shooting.
Draw length: The bow grip to string distance at full draw is an important factor in optimizing its fit to you and your arm/wrist. Selecting the correct draw length will guarantee proper fitting, improved accuracy and power output from your compound bow.
Cams and Cables: Compound bow limbs feature extra strings, cables, and cams that mechanically manipulate the draw weight when you pull back on the string. These components help transfer energy from your draw back into the limbs so it can be transformed into kinetic energy that's released onto your arrow when released.
